Paulo Serodio is a senior research officer and interdisciplinary scholar specializing in political economy and data-driven methods. Based in Colchester, UK, he leads research at the University of Essex and holds an associate membership at the University of Oxford, with collaborations across Europe. His nine-year track record spans roles at Northeastern, Oxford, Universitat de Barcelona, and the Institute of Complex Systems in Paris, reflecting a truly international research footprint. He earned a PhD in Political Economy from the University of Essex, following an MA in Comparative Politics and a BA in Political Science and International Relations. His work centers on network science, econometrics, data analysis, text analysis, and machine learning, with applications to political economy and economic history. He is known for integrating rigorous quantitative methods with policy-relevant research and for fostering cross-institutional collaborations.
